Schindler · Easy Altivar ATV310 Drive
This ATV310 fault detects a short-circuit condition at the drive's output, impacting the motor or cabling. It can be triggered either at the run command or during a DC injection command, especially if parameter 608 (IGBT Test) is set to 01.

Disconnect the motor from the ATV310 drive's output terminals.
Check the cables connecting the drive to the motor for any short circuits (phase-to-phase or phase-to-ground) using a multimeter.
Test the motor winding insulation resistance with a megohmmeter (megger) to ensure there are no ground faults or inter-phase shorts.
Verify parameter 608 (IGBT Test) setting; if set to 01, ensure the motor and cabling are correctly installed and checked before attempting to run.
